    Great video. I would add a few things. Check seacocks, check anchor and windless, check life vests/jackets (CO2 if they have any), and for a sailing vessel, check standing rigging, check running rigging and check winches.

    Why did you not turn on your Auxiliary switch? Do you not have a generator? What does the Auxiliary switch do please?

    • @TMGYachts
      @TMGYachts  ปีที่แล้ว

      @angelaevans3457 the Aux switches are often spare switches the manufacture places in so you can add electrical systems if you wish. For instance, you could add 12V televisions on board or fans, you could then wire up this switch as it's isolator for these.
